Leased lock

The leased lock provides a lock service that can be used in an embedded and distributed manner. The idea is to provide locks that are somewhere between a mutex and a binary semaphore in terms of ownership semantics plus also provide leasing in order for us to not indefinitely hold on to shared resources. Locks come with fencing tokens which should be propagated across applications using the lock service. These fencing tokens allow for safe modifications of shared resources.

The interface provided is simple enough to provide support for more backend implementations based off of a database or a file system.

Reentrant lock support

Add support for a reentrant read/write lock which can maintain a pair of associated locks - one for read-only operations and one for writing. The read lock may be held simultaneously by multiple reader processes, so long as there are no writers. The write lock should be exclusive. This lock should allow both readers and writers to reacquire read or write locks in the style of a re-entrant lock. Additionally, a writer should be able to acquire the read lock, but not vice-versa. If a reader tries to acquire the write lock, it should never succeed.
